活动介绍
file-type

Tomcat 7.0.33版本下载:绿色与安装版合集

ZIP文件

下载需积分: 9 | 49.32MB | 更新于2025-08-28 | 143 浏览量 | 6 下载量 举报 收藏
download 立即下载
Tomcat 是由 Apache 软件基金会(Apache Software Foundation)下属的 Jakarta 项目开发和维护的一个开源的 Servlet 容器,它实现了 Java Servlet 和 JavaServer Pages(JSP)规范,是 Apache、JBoss、Jetty 等 Web 服务器的扩展。Tomcat 也被称为 Jakarta Tomcat 或者简称Tomcat。在本文件中,我们主要关注的是 Tomcat 版本 7.0.33。 ### 知识点一:Tomcat v7.0.33 版本特性 Tomcat v7.0.33 是 Tomcat 7 系列中的一个版本,它在 2013 年发布,主要遵循 Java Servlet 3.0 和 JavaServer Pages 2.2 规范。该版本主要更新包括了安全方面的修复和性能改进。用户应查阅官方文档以获取具体的更新日志和改动详情。 ### 知识点二:安装版与绿色版的区别 在本文件中提到了 Tomcat v7.0.33 的安装版和绿色版,以下是两者之间的一些区别: - **安装版(apache-tomcat-7.0.33.exe)**: - 安装版 Tomcat 通常是一个安装向导程序,支持 Windows 平台。 - 安装后会将 Tomcat 相关文件安装到指定目录,并可进行系统服务注册,使用 Windows 的服务管理器启动或停止 Tomcat。 - 安装过程可能会对系统环境变量进行配置,以简化 Tomcat 的使用。 - **绿色版**: - 绿色版通常指的是不需要安装即可直接运行的版本,解压即用。 - 这种版本不会修改系统的环境变量,也不需要安装过程,适用于不想改变系统设置的用户。 - 绿色版通常以压缩包(如 .tar.gz、.zip)形式发布,不同压缩包后缀对应不同的操作系统和平台(比如 Windows、Linux 或 MacOS)。 ### 知识点三:文件名列表详解 在文件名列表中,我们看到了多个不同的文件名。它们代表了 Tomcat v7.0.33 在不同操作系统平台上的部署格式,具体包括: - **apache-tomcat-7.0.33.exe**:适用于 Windows 平台的安装程序。 - **apache-tomcat-7.0.33.tar.gz**:适用于类 Unix 系统的压缩包,其中 `.tar` 是一种打包格式,`.gz` 表示使用了 GZIP 压缩。 - **apache-tomcat-7.0.33-windows-i64.zip**、**apache-tomcat-7.0.33-windows-x64.zip**、**apache-tomcat-7.0.33-windows-x86.zip**:这些是为 Windows 平台准备的压缩包,分别是为不同架构的系统编译的版本。其中 “i64”、“x64” 和 “x86” 分别表示不同的 CPU 架构:Intel 64 位架构、AMD64 或 Intel 64 位架构、Intel x86 或兼容架构。 - **apache-tomcat-7.0.33.zip**:这是一个适用于 Windows 平台的压缩包,不过没有指明是32位还是64位。 ### 知识点四:Tomcat 的部署与应用 部署 Tomcat 通常包括以下几个步骤: 1. **下载与解压**:根据操作系统下载对应的版本,并解压到本地文件系统中。 2. **环境变量设置**(针对绿色版或特定配置):配置系统的环境变量,如 `JAVA_HOME` 和 `CATALINA_HOME`。`JAVA_HOME` 指向 Java 开发工具包(JDK)的安装目录,而 `CATALINA_HOME` 指向 Tomcat 的安装目录。 3. **运行 Tomcat**:通过命令行界面运行 `startup.bat`(Windows)或 `startup.sh`(Unix/Linux)来启动 Tomcat 服务器。 4. **测试部署**:在浏览器中输入 `http://localhost:8080`(默认端口号为8080)来测试 Tomcat 是否正常运行。 5. **部署 Web 应用**:将 Web 应用程序的 WAR 文件复制到 `CATALINA_HOME/webapps` 目录下,Tomcat 会自动识别并部署。 ### 知识点五:Tomcat 的目录结构 Tomcat 的默认目录结构如下: - **bin/**:包含启动和关闭 Tomcat 的脚本文件。 - **conf/**:包含主要的配置文件,如 `server.xml` 和 `web.xml`。 - **lib/**:包含 Tomcat 和所有部署应用共享的库(JAR 文件)。 - **logs/**:包含日志文件,用于记录服务器和应用的日志。 - **webapps/**:存放部署的 Web 应用。 - **work/**:存放 JSP 编译后生成的 Java 源文件和 Class 文件。 - **temp/**:存放临时文件。 ### 知识点六:安全性与维护 维护 Tomcat 服务器时,用户需注意以下几点: - **安全更新**:定期检查并更新到最新的安全补丁和版本,以避免已知的安全漏洞。 - **用户认证与授权**:使用 `tomcat-users.xml` 文件配置适当的用户认证和授权,确保应用的安全性。 - **连接器配置**:配置合适的连接器(Connector)以优化性能,如调整最大连接数和接受超时。 - **资源管理**:监控 Tomcat 的资源使用情况,包括 CPU、内存等,根据应用需要适当调整。 综上所述,Tomcat v7.0.33 是一个稳定版本,用户在使用时应了解其安装与配置,以及如何维护和确保 Tomcat 环境的安全性。选择合适的部署方式和文件,以及了解其目录结构和运行原理,对开发和部署 Java Web 应用至关重要。

相关推荐

ylg5132976
  • 粉丝: 2
上传资源 快速赚钱